SubjectBig file support in Linux 2.2


Hello,

For one of our projects here, we've crashed head first into the 2 gig file size
limitation in Linux 2.2 kernels. While I know that this has been solved in
2.3/2.4, has there been any work to backport this feature into a Linux 2.2
kernel? I'm looking for a temporary solution until we can move to Linux 2.4
directly, but obviously not until after it's been "really" released. :)

Yes, I know this is likely to be relatively unstable. (Probably almost as
unstable as running a 2.4-pre kernel in production), but at least it would give
us a start.
